Solving Everyday Plumbing Issues in Glendale

Low water pressure, frequent blockages, and mineral buildup are common daily problems for Glendale residents; many of these problems in older communities arise from aging pipes, hard water, or root damage. Our staff offers trusted Glendale, AZ residential plumbing repairs meant to address the underlying cause rather than only the symptoms.
